How could you make a difference as a Kitchen Assistant with us: Hygiene and cleanliness is crucial to us, and you will contribute towards this by ensuring that food preparation and service areas, tools and utensils are clean and hygienic at all times. Working individually and as part of a team, you'll also be very visible to our residents by assisting with the preparation and serving of meals and refreshments. We offer comprehensive learning and development opportunities and welcome candidates with a variety of different experiences.
What do you need to succeed: Previous experience of working within a busy kitchen environment is an advantage; however, we also offer comprehensive training to help you to succeed in your new role.

How to prepare for a job interview at Beechwood Grove
✨Know Your Kitchen Basics
Even if you don't have previous kitchen experience, it's a good idea to familiarise yourself with basic kitchen terminology and practices. Brush up on food hygiene standards and common kitchen tools. This will show your enthusiasm and readiness to learn during the interview.
✨Show Your Passion for Food
Make sure to express your love for food and cooking during the interview. Share any personal experiences or favourite dishes that inspire you. This can help the interviewer see your genuine interest in the role and how you could fit into their team.
✨Prepare Questions to Ask
Interviews are a two-way street! Prepare thoughtful questions about the training process, team dynamics, and what a typical day looks like. This not only shows your interest but also helps you gauge if this is the right environment for you.
✨Emphasise Teamwork Skills
As a Kitchen Assistant, you'll be working closely with others. Highlight any past experiences where you've successfully worked as part of a team, whether in a kitchen or another setting. This will demonstrate your ability to collaborate and contribute positively to the work environment.
